S4:175 Isaiah 42-46

Jul 23, 2025
Dive into the profound themes of Isaiah 42, where the hosts unravel the identity of the anointed servant, revealing connections to Jesus as our burden carrier. Personal testimonies bring to life the community's role in spiritual growth. They explore the characteristics of this divine servant, highlighting traits of justice and gentleness that offer hope and freedom, especially for the Gentiles. The discussion encourages listeners to reflect on their own burdens and embrace the warmth of a compassionate figure who offers rest.

INSIGHT

Messiah as Gentle Servant

  • The "servant of the Lord" in Isaiah 42 is the Messiah, Jesus Christ.
  • He is characterized as just, gentle, steadfast, and a light to the nations who frees captives.
